Mymoviles Europa 2000, S.L. – €1,500 Fine (Spain, 2020)

Mymoviles Europa 2000, S.L. was fined for not having a privacy statement on its website and not clearly identifying itself in its legal notice. What happened
The company failed to publish a privacy statement on its website and did not clearly identify itself in its legal notice.
Who was affected
The affected individuals were website visitors who lacked access to clear information about data handling practices.
What the authority found
The AEPD fined Mymoviles Europa 2000, S.L. for not providing necessary transparency about its data processing activities, violating GDPR requirements.
